“The Court and Community Corrections make regular referrals… and their holistic range of services has become such an important service for us.
Their facilitated groups for both men and women (Sorted! and Empower) have helped many of our clients make enormous progress in understanding their emotions and motivations.

An aspect of best practise in therapeutic court is to facilitate and introduce participants to partner agencies who can provide positive and constructive experiences. [They] have a proven track record of understanding our clients and helping them become ordinary normal human beings – so often the simple and fundamental desire of a recovering drug addicted person.”

“The Drug Court NSW is delighted to work closely with Break the Cycle at Glenquarie…”
